Problem

Existing scent-based training aids and toys have non-renewable scents, limiting their use and lacking control over scent release, which restricts their effectiveness in training and rewarding animals.

Innovation Solution

A device with a housing containing scented material, vents for controlled scent release, and an activator to manage scent emission, allowing for replaceable and adjustable scent levels, enhancing training efficacy.

The invention provides an animal training aid or to for use in scent based animal training or activities. The aid or toy comprises: a housing comprising an interior cavity configured to contain a scented material that releases substantially no scent that is desirable to the animal in an unactivated state and releases a scent that is desirable to the animal in an activated state; one or more vents on an external surface of the housing, each vent in communication with the interior cavity so that a scent from the scented material can be released from the interior cavity to the exterior of the housing where it can be detected by the animal; and an activator for activating the scented material from the unactivated state to the activated state, the activator being operable from the external surface of the housing.
